Question : Murray riding mower engine swap – 14.5 Tecumsah (I/C Quiet #287707) from a 42910x92a replacing a 14.5 Tecumsah (Enduro #204020A) in a 40715x99a. Both engines have the 2 wires from the coil, no problem there. The problems are that the 92a engine has a 2 wire switch on the floatbowl of the carb (the 99a doesn’t) and the 99a has a single green wire leading up towards the front top of the engine under the heat shield (the 92a doesn’t). Any ideas for the proper rewiring?

Answer : The 287707 is a briggs engine. It requires two wires. Use 2 wire connector from that engine. One of the wires is the ground and one is the hot.
